Revision as of 06:18, 25 December 2012
- This is the Cover Card of Duelist Pack: Kaiba
- This card has the highest ATK and DEF of any non-Effect Monster in the game.
- This card also has the third highest original ATK of any monster in the game at 4500, tied with "Rainbow Neos", "Neo Galaxy-Eyes Photon Dragon" and "Number 22 Franken".
- This card is needed to Special Summon "Blue-Eyes Shining Dragon". However, "Blue-Eyes Shining Dragon" was released in the TCG in August 2004, a year and a half before this card was released, so before then, "Blue-Eyes Shining Dragon" was completely unplayable, even though it was technically legal for tournament use.
- The reprinted GLD1 version of this card has mistakenly been printed with 3000 DEF instead of 3800 DEF.
- The ATK, DEF, and Level of "Blue-Eyes Ultimate Dragon" are all equal to half those of 3 "Blue-Eyes White Dragon" added up, respectively, though the DEF is rounded up to the nearest hundred.
- The Bandai version of this card is the "Blue-Eyes White Dragon's 3-Body Connection"
- In some of the Yu-Gi-Oh video games, the "Blue-Eyes Ultimate Dragon" had the DIVINE attribute, although it is in-fact a LIGHT monster.
- In a few video games, such as Forbidden Memories and The Duelists of the Roses, the Ritual card "Ultimate Dragon" was needed to summon "Blue Eyes Ultimate Dragon".
- "Cyber End Dragon" is the Machine-type version of this card.
- "Neo Galaxy-Eyes Photon Dragon" is the Yu-Gi-Oh! ZEXAL counterpart to this card.
- This monster could have been based off of the Godzilla monster King Ghidorah, as they share many similarities being that they are both three-headed dragons, that they are said to be near indestructible, and their primary attacks are bolts of lightning fired from their mouths.
- This card, "D.3.S. Frog", "Mokey Mokey King" and "Cyber End Dragon" are the only Fusion Monsters to use three of the same monster as Fusion Material Monsters.
- This card is the first Level 12 card to appear in the anime.
- In Yu-Gi-Oh! ZEXAL - Episode 015, this card is featured as a statue.
